How they compare
Papua New Guinea currently reports 319.26 current US$ per person against 119.46 current US$ per person in Burundi, a difference of 199.8 current US$ per person.
That makes Papua New Guinea's figure about 2.7 times Burundi's.
Across all 44 years both countries report, Papua New Guinea has been ahead every year.
Burundi ranks 189th and Papua New Guinea ranks 188th of 190 countries.
Papua New Guinea has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Burundi | Papua New Guinea |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 57.34 current US$ per person | 107.05 current US$ per person | 49.7 current US$ per person | Papua New Guinea |
| 1970s | 91.2 current US$ per person | 261.33 current US$ per person | 170.13 current US$ per person | Papua New Guinea |
| 1980s | 188 current US$ per person | 514.9 current US$ per person | 326.9 current US$ per person | Papua New Guinea |
| 1990s | 147.31 current US$ per person | 495.71 current US$ per person | 348.4 current US$ per person | Papua New Guinea |
| 2000s | 113.38 current US$ per person | 290.36 current US$ per person | 176.98 current US$ per person | Papua New Guinea |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
